FilemakerTurk, AYS Bilişim ve Beyaz Net tarafından desteklenmektedir.
Filemaker Danışmanınız
AYS Bilişim
Mehmet KAYA
 0532 231 07 27
 0216 318 55 80
 mkaya@aysbilisim.net
						

value listi scriptle uygulayıp yönetebilirmiyiz?

+1 oy
561 kez görüntülendi
scriptle Value listi ilişkideki tablonun şunlarını göstersin bu mümkünmü mümkünse hangi komuttur?
4, Haziran, 2015 Scripts kategorisinde Muhteshem (52,960 puan) tarafından soruldu

3 Cevaplar

0 oy
Karizmatikalem'in (Hamit Bey) bununla ilgili bir sorusu vardı : http://filemakerturk.com/2289/executesql-relation-yapmadan-calisan-valuelist-yapilirmi
4, Haziran, 2015 F. Osman Cabi (198,180 puan) tarafından cevaplandı
0 oy
Mümkündür fakat komut ile değil yöntem ile yapılabilir fakat bu yöntemin kullanılmısı 1000 ve üzeri kayıtlarda sistemi çok yavaşlatacaktır. http://filemakerturk.com/2289/executesql-relation-yapmadan-calisan-valuelist-yapilirmi buradaki örnek dosyayı inceleyin. Hesaplama alanı değiştirlerek bunu yapmak mümkün fakat filemakerin yapısı butür işlemlere müsait değildir.
4, Haziran, 2015 Goksel_Gokce (96,900 puan) tarafından cevaplandı
" bunu yapmak mümkün fakat filemakerin yapısı butür işlemlere müsait değildir."
kesinlikle katılıyorum.

Bunu isteme sebebiniz nedir? Script'le value list oluşturmanın ne avantajı olacağını düşünüyorsunuz?
BUNU YAPMAK İÇİN İSTİYORUM

              grup      kod
marka   infinive    01
marka   Bmv        02
marka    Mersedes 03
Marka    serçe        04
Marka    Mazda      05
segment  lüx           01
segment  orta          02
segment  düşük       03
model      2000         01
model      2001          02
model       2003          03

bunları bir loyauta sıraladım zamanla eklenebilir olsun diye
başka bir loyautta
marka fieldi bu fieldde sadece marka olanlar gözğkecek infinitive seçince marka fieldine infinitive markodu fieldine 01 yazacak
aynı şekilde segment fieldi olacak aynı işlemi burda yapacak
model fieldi olacak aynı işlemi burda yapacak
bu şekilde katagorileri çoğalttıkça fieldi de açılıp devapedip gidecek Sonsuza dek değil tabiiki;))
Conditional Value List (Koşullu değer listesi) bunun için biçilmiş kaftan. Birinci alanınız (marka, segment vs yazan) "İL", ikinci alan "İLÇE" olduğunu düşünün.

İki alanı seçtikten sonra kod değerini de bir ilişki üzerinden getirebilirsiniz.

İl-ilçe örneğini inceleyebilirsiniz: http://www.filemakerturk.com/338/illere-ait-il%C3%A7eleri-g%C3%B6sterme-nas%C4%B1l-yap%C4%B1l%C4%B1r?show=349#a349
kaydın yapılacağı loyautta 2 tane fieldim olsa biçilmiş kaftandı her segmentin ayrı fieldi olacak her fielde aynı il ilçe gibi bağlarsakta her segment 3 fieldden oluşacak şöyle

marka fildinde marka seçicem diğer filde serçeyi seçecem kodunu lookap yapıcam
segment fieldi sgmend seçicem lüksü seçince kodu gelecek kod için lookup nasıl gelecek gelmesi için ilşkilerde liste loyautunu çoltmam gerekecek mi? gerekmezse kod nasıl gelecek

model fieldi açıcam modeli seçince  2001 seçtim kodu nun gelmesi için ilişkilerde bir table daha çoğaltıcam mı?

bunları düşündüğüm için daha basitini arıyorum bu mümkünmü? işte tam burdayım bu katagoriler çoğalacağı için karmaşık olacağından korkuyorum

model fieldinde modeli seçicem
Bu yazılımın amacı ne ?
Web uygulamalarında olduğu gibi yapmak mümkündür. Sonuçta sql ama sql kullabıldığında filemaker mysql veya mssql kadar performans göstermeyecektir. Az kayıtta veya dikkatli kodlanmasında sorun çıkmaz.
Stok yönetimi antramanı.....
sql falan anlamam ne yaparsa fm yapsın anladığım kadarıyla olamayacak  (üzüntü şekli)
case devam
Sql sqldir php java c++ filemaker farketmez. Ayrıca işi yapabilmek için sql hakim olmak gerekir ayrıca int dökümanlardan biraz farklıdır fmpnin sql. Bence bildiğiniz yöntem ile yapın.
Tamam...........................
siz görörsünüzBunu FM ye yazıcam::))
0 oy
Evet arkadaşlar istediğimi yaptım çok basitmiş:))

marka adının olduğu fieldi edit li valuelist yaptım, serçeyi seçti ğimde script çalışıyor id den matching yapıp serçeyi set variableye tutturdum listenin olduğu leyouta gidip serçeyi buldurdum  bunun yanındaki kodu copy edip geri loyautageldim serçenin koduna paste ettim bu şekilde birçok fielde uygulayacağım kasarmı kasmazmı zamanla göreciğiz.........
4, Haziran, 2015 Muhteshem (52,960 puan) tarafından cevaplandı
...